System Overview
2.3.9 Graphics Subsystem
These systems use the Q35 GMCH component, which includes an integrated graphics controller
that can drive an external VGA monitor. The controller implements Dynamic Video Memory
Technology (DVMT 3.0) for video memory. Table 2-5 lists the key features of the integrated
graphics subsystem.
The IGC supports dual independent display for expanding the desktop viewing area across two
monitors. The USDT form factor includes a DVI-D interface for direct connection with a digital
video monitor. The graphics subsystem of the SFF and CMT systems can be upgraded by
installing an SDVO ADD2 card or PCIe x16 graphics card in the PCIe x16 graphics slot.
2.3.10 Audio Subsystem
These systems use the integrated High Definitions audio controller of the chipset and the ADI
AD1884 High Definition audio codec. HD audio provides improvements over AC’97 audio such
as higher sampling rates, refined signal interfaces, and audio processors with a higher
signal-to-noise ratio. The audio line input jack can be re-configured as a microphone input, and
multi-streaming is supported. These systems include a 1.5-watt output amplifier driving an
internal speaker.
All models include front panel-accessible stereo microphone in and headphone
out audio jacks.
